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Nestled in the rolling hills just south of downtown York, Regents' Glen Country Club is situated in a locale that balances convenient access with a serene, pastoral setting. Major arteries like Interstate 83 and US Route 30 are easily reachable, providing direct routes to and from the club. Harrisburg International Airport (MDT) serves as the primary gateway for air travelers, typically a 30-40 minute drive away via I-83 North. For those driving, numerous parking options are available on-site, with dedicated areas for members and guests. During peak event times or prime golf season, arriving 15-20 minutes before your scheduled tee time or event is advisable to navigate parking and check-in procedures smoothly. Rideshare services are also an option, though drop-off and pick-up points should be confirmed with club staff upon arrival, especially during busy periods.

Golf Course Itself

On site

Regents' Glen Country Club is renowned for its challenging and scenic 18-hole championship golf course, designed by Arthur Hills. The layout features rolling fairways, strategically placed bunkers, and immaculate greens, offering a true test for golfers of all skill levels. Each hole presents unique challenges and picturesque views, making the course a destination in itself. Beyond the game, the course provides a tranquil escape, immersing players in the natural beauty of the Pennsylvania landscape. It’s the primary attraction, offering a memorable golfing experience from the first tee to the final putt.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in York typically brings cold temperatures, with average highs in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Snowfall is possible, though usually moderate. Visitors should pack warm layers, including a heavy coat, hat, and gloves. Outdoor activities like golf are limited or unavailable, and the focus shifts to indoor events and cozy evenings.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ring offers gradually warming temperatures, with average highs climbing into the 60s and 70s. Expect a mix of sunny days and occasional rain showers. Lightweight layers are ideal, along with a light jacket or sweater for cooler mornings and evenings. This is a prime season for golf, with the course coming alive after winter dormancy.

☀️

Mid-summer

Summers in York are typically warm to hot, with average highs in the 80s and low 90s Fahrenheit. Humidity can be significant. Light, breathable clothing like shorts, t-shirts, and sundresses are comfortable.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are essential for outdoor activities. Early morning or late afternoon tee times are recommended to avoid the strongest sun and heat.

🍂

Fall season

Fall is characterized by crisp, pleasant weather, with average highs in the 60s and 70s, gradually cooling into the 50s. The foliage provides beautiful scenery. Layering clothing is key, with comfortable pants, long-sleeved shirts, and a light to medium jacket. This is a peak season for golf, offering ideal conditions for enjoying the course surrounded by autumn colors.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is possible throughout the year, with heavier amounts often occurring in spring and summer. Snow is most common in winter. Always check the forecast before your visit and pack accordingly. Rain gear, umbrellas, and waterproof footwear are advisable. During winter, snow can impact travel and course accessibility, so it's wise to confirm conditions with the club.
